ECM과 Silk Fibroin 지지체의 in vivo 와 in vitro에서의 조직적합성 및 독성 테스트
초록
PURPOSE : Recently, cell-based approaches using neural stem/progenitor or mesenchymal stem cells in combination with biomaterials for brain tissue engineering have been actively developed. In this study, we investigated the biocompatibility and toxicity of two biomaterials, chondrocyte derived ECM (ECM) scaffold and silk fibroin (SF) scaffold in vitro and in vivo for their use in brain tissue engineering MATERIALS AND METHODS : MSCs were isolated from the bone marrow of 100g adult male SD rats. The wst-1 assay, cell attachment and H&E stain were carried out to assess the biocompatibility of the two scaffolds in vitro. For in vivo test, the 6-mm diameter craniotomy was performed at bregma, and then a cortical tissue was removed mechanically by 6-mm biopsy-punch. ECM and SF were transplanted into the lesion cavity of the injured brain, and the rats were sacrificed 7, 21, and 42 days after TBI. Thirty-six male SD rats were randomly divided into four groups with 9 rats per group (i.e. Sham, TBI, TBI+ECM, TBI+SF) for behavioral test. Motor function was measured using rota-rod test and Modified Neurological Severity Scores (mNSS). All the time points of the brain tissue was processed for histopathological analysis. RESULTS : The ECM scaffold had much higher cell viability and attachment to MSCs, compared with SF scaffold in vitro. ECM and SF scaffolds implanted into the lesion area of the cortex still existed in the site after being grafted for 6 weeks. For the lesion volume, SF group was significantly larger than all other groups at 6 weeks. There was no significant differences in the rota-rod test and mNsscores between control, ECM and SF groups. With immunohistochemistry after 1, 3 and 6 weeks of implantation, GFAP-positive astrocytes could be seen around the grafts in the three groups.
